Pay for Performance (P4P) :: Altarum - Healthcare Value Hub

(6 days ago) WEBPay-for-Performance (P4P) is an alternative payment model in which participating providers can receive bonus payments for meeting quality/efficiency targets. Providers that do not perform well may be financially penalized, “thus providing a significant linkage between payment and quality.”1 Incentives can range from small bonuses for a few

Quality Improvement and Pay for Performance - CHEST

(7 days ago) WEBLinking health-care quality improvement to payment appears straightforward. Improve the care that one provides to one's patients, and one is rewarded financially. Should one fail to improve care, then one is financially penalized. However, this strategy assumes that health-care workers and administrators possess the necessary tools and knowledge to improve …
